Rod March

Posts 119
22 Aug 2019 00:23


Yes, the 2.12 RC2 x10 rendered floating-point for 60hrs straight without a problem. (once you're on to LW 4.0 + it's floating point only anyway, only 3.5 still has an integer version)
 
Now running x12, haven't run that overnight yet, but I've had no problems over shorter runs.

Rod March

Posts 119
11 Nov 2019 22:11


I can't comment on rounding issues, but Lightwave renders and problem-free for me with the latest Gold 2.12 (it really does need to be the latest one though).
   
No lock-ups, no funky results (that I have noticed), I can cancel renders at any time.
   
Santiago, I suspect your ESC-not-working problem is related to the keyboard itself or some other part of your system. You might want to try CTRL-ALT-F10, which will quit the whole switcher interface  (if you are running LW though the VT card).
   
A bit drastic to just stop a render, but less hassle than a total restart, and it may get you closer to figuring out your core problem.

Posts 47
18 Nov 2019 23:34


Hey Rod. I use NewMode to promote the screen.
There you can select which resolution do you want to use Layout or Modeler and from there, it will work with your RTG Vampire system.

You can download NewMode from Aminet. It needs to be in WBStartup.

Let me know if you need help, but is very straight forward.
